#298f21 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#298f21 is composed of 16.1% red, 56.1%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.9%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 115.6 degrees, a saturation of 62.5% and a lightness of 34.5%. #298f21 color hex could be obtained by blending #52ff42 with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#298f21 color description : Dark lime green.

The hexadecimal color #298f21 has RGB values of R:41, G:143, B:33 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 2723617.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#041004 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575957 is the less saturated color, while #12aa06 is the most saturated one.
